We hope to provide this in the Nursery and in the community, by offering a safe, secure and happy environment in which children will feel confident and ready to learn.
 
Children are supported by highly qualified and experienced staff who are committed to providing quality education and support. We thrive on offering experiences and opportunities that challenge and excite the children in our care.

We provide full daycare, paid sessions and funded sessions for children aged 3 months to 5 years. We accept funding for 2, 3 and 4 year olds including the new 30 hours funding available to working parents.
 
YMCA Childcare also provide a breakfast and after school club for children aged 5 to 11 years. We have a holiday club available for children aged 3months to 10 years 11 months.

In our settings, children take part in a variety of child-chosen and adult-led activities. We operate ‘free-flow play’ where children can move indoors and outdoors of their own free will, regardless of the weather, throughout the day. Learning through play helps the children develop at their own pace; having fun, making friends, and learning as they play to become confident, secure children.

Each of our Childcare settings operates a key person system where a member of staff will work with parents and carers to ensure the nursery provides what is right for the child’s particular needs and interests. The key person will form attachments with children, parents, and carers, helping to settle children into the routine and undertaking care routines.
